Heritage Unveils 7 Policy Priorities for 2022 and Beyond - The Heritage Foundation and Heritage Action for America today announced a set of strategic policy priorities that will form the roadmap for conservatives over the next three years. 

Education: Half of all Americans (50%) say “parents of school-aged children should have a role in deciding what is taught in public schools,” while 50% also believe “we should have school choice programs which allow parents to use some of the money that government would spend to educate their child in traditional public school to send them to the public, private, or charter school of their choosing.”  Heritage Expert: Jonathan Butcher 

Rule of law: A majority of Americans (64%) disapprove of the job President Biden and Congress have done addressing illegal immigration and the crisis at the southern border and believe they should reinstate some previous Trump administration policies (61%). Heritage Experts: Lora Ries and Mike Howell

Election integrity: Most Americans support photo IDs to vote (79%) and oppose vote trafficking practices like ballot harvesting (66%). Heritage Expert: Hans von Spakovsky 

Spending and inflation: 80% of Republicans and a plurality of independents (43%) blame reckless government spending, rather than COVID, for historic inflation. Heritage Expert: Joel Griffith

China: Most Americans believe “China’s military expansion and aggressiveness is a direct threat to the national security of America” (74%) and that “China has been stealing American jobs and technology for decades and it’s time we stop depending on China” (87%). Heritage Experts: Dean Cheng and Olivia Enos

Big Tech: Most Americans (82%) believe “Big Tech companies have too much power over their platforms and have used it to expand their control of the public debate and shape our politics.” Heritage Expert: Kara Frederick

Protecting life: A majority of Americans support limits on abortion (56%) and banning taxpayer funding for abortions (65%). Heritage Expert: Melanie Israel

Biden’s transformation of federal judiciary in full swing - President Biden took office in January 2021 with clear instructions about undoing his predecessor’s impact on the federal judiciary. Weeks earlier, more than 70 liberal groups issued a statement urging Mr. Biden to appoint judges who would advance “the administration’s priorities” on a range of issues. Their demand became Mr. Biden’s plan and, while a lot of attention is focused on his first Supreme Court nominee, he already has made significant progress in pushing the judiciary in that more liberal, politicized direction.
